Question missed start date for yasmin

Hi everyone,

I was supposed to start taking Yasmin the Sunday after my period started. that was last week and i was out of town so had no access to my pharmacy (hadn't even picked up the pills, figured it would be a while before i got a period) so now am i supposed to wait who knows how long before i can start them?

Has anyone else started differently? Will it make a huge difference?

The reasoning behind a Sunday start is in theory you may get weekends off from your period. You can also start the pill the first day of your period. Figuring the first Sunday following AF didn't follow much logic beyond practicle matters, I used to do a Thursday start, since that was the way that did get me weekends off (Sunday start never did since I never got AF till Wed)

As long as it has been less than a week since AF started, just start the pills and you'll probably be OK.

If it has been more than a week, I would say just start the pills and use back up protection (condoms) the first month if you have sex.

You can double up for two missed days, I believe, so if you wanted, if it's been a week and a fay or a week and two days, you could double up one or two days - but I would still suggest back up BC the first month.

A small word of caution - my "oops" happened when I started the pill at random (no period) and didn't use back up the first month. I got pregnant during the first week or so on the pill.
